Life comes with many demands beyond the goals we set for ourselves, which don’t lessen with time, but rather multiples with every passing year. Focusing too broadly on all the things that need to be done can stress out even the most organized. If you learn how to narrow your focus into smaller chunks or steps that are easier to conquer in your day-to-day living, you’ll be amazed at what you accomplish when you take the time to reflect back on where you started. But the key is not looking up at the massive mountain ahead of you. If you’re feeling overwhelmed in your life, there’s a good chance that you’re doing just that. My advice; look at the few feet in front of you instead. Believe me, tomorrow will always be there and world will keep spinning even if you couldn’t get it all done today.
